April 2026 update arrives for Galaxy S26 series, setting foundation for One UI 8.5
Samsung just kicked off the April 2026 security update rollout to the Galaxy S26 series. The company shipped its latest phones with One UI 8.5 preinstalled, but the April patch is a foundation for all existing models, including the S25 series.
Itβs April Foolβs Day today, but Samsung is serious. The company began the rollout of the April 2026 security update for its latest flagships, the Galaxy S26 series. The OTA is currently rolling out in Korea, as confirmed by AndroidFlatform.
Samsung has been testing One UI 8.5 Beta since December. We are entering April 2026, and itβs high time for a Stable update. Galaxy S25 users, around the world, are eagerly awaiting the public rollout of the One UI 8.5 update.
Update Details
Security code applied
- Stability improvements related to security have been applied
The updateβs changelog specifically mentions that this update enhances the security status of your Galaxy device. Users who are installing the April OTA wonβt be able to roll back to a previous version with lower security.
Pay attention, the content may vary depending on your device model, country, and carrier. Simply put, the changelog may not look the same as Korean when it arrives in other markets.
Samsung recommends users to regularly check for new software updates and upgrade. It will ensure the peak level of system stability and privacy on your Galaxy devices.
The company has not yet published the April 2026 patch details. The updated page and roadmap are expected to go official later this week, which will be an important document for Galaxy users.
